Epic Storyline: Heller’s Vengeful Rampage

After a terrible Blacklight virus outbreak, Sgt. James Heller goes back to New York City, which is now a dystopian wasteland called New York Zero. He was sent home from the war and found that the plague had killed his wife and daughter. This made him want to kill himself. Alex Mercer, the main character from the first game, sneaks up on Heller’s squad in the Red Zone’s chaos and infects him with the virus, giving him superhuman powers. Heller wakes up in a Gentek lab, escapes, and teams up with Mercer, who tells him about Blackwatch and Gentek’s part in the disaster. Heller tears down their operations in all of NYZ’s zones because he is angry.

Heller goes through the Green Zone’s military base, the Yellow Zone’s tense quarantine, and the Red Zone’s infected horrors, gathering information through Blackboxes and destroying lairs. As he hunts down important people, betrayals happen, and he finally faces Mercer. Explosive Gameplay: Shapeshift, Consume, Destroy

In Prototype 2, the third-person action is smooth and takes place in a Manhattan that can be destroyed. The city is divided into color-coded zones full of Blackwatch forces and mutants. The main mechanics are eating enemies to get biomass to heal, pretending to be a civilian or soldier to sneak in, and changing your limbs into deadly weapons like Claw, Blade, Whipfist, Hammerfists, or Tendrils. With parkour skills, you can glide across skyscrapers, steal tanks for Gatling guns, or use Biobombs to blow up infected hordes. You can mix two abilities, like Shield and Tendril barrages, with upgrades through a power wheel. You can also learn more about the game’s story and unlock stronger enemies, like Goliaths, by hacking Blacknet. Vehicle combat, boss arenas, and destroying the environment add depth, and sonar pulses help find targets in the middle of all the action. Prototype 2 System Requirements: PC, Android, and Gamehub Specs

Component PC Minimum PC Recommended
OS Windows XP/Vista/7 Windows 7
CPU Intel Core 2 Duo 2.6GHz / AMD Phenom X3 8750 Intel Core 2 Quad 2.7GHz / AMD Phenom II X4 3GHz
RAM 2 GB 4 GB
GPU NVIDIA GeForce 8800 GT 512MB / ATI Radeon HD 4850 512MB NVIDIA GeForce GTX 460 1GB
Storage 10 GB 10 GB
